Intermediate Developer
Company | AMA |
---|---|
Location | Edmonton, AB, Canada |
Salary | $Not Provided – $Not Provided |
Type | Full-Time |
Degrees | Bachelor’s |
Experience Level | Mid Level |
Requirements
- You have a university degree or technical school diploma in a related technical field such as Information Technology or Computer Science.
- You have at least 3 years of development experience.
- You’re comfortable working with data security at rest and in transit.
- You’re also at ease with Application Programming Interface (API) management and design.
- You have experience with the following languages: Java/C#, Javascript, Git (Azure DevOps, GitHub), SQL (queries, views, stored procedures)
Responsibilities
- Reporting to the Team Lead, Insurance Applications, you’ll be working with the Guidewire Insurance Suite, Guidewire Digital, and the various integration points that support those products.
- Participate in the design and implementation of IT service management standards, tools and methodologies.
- Seeking to build in security during the development of software systems.
- Investigate new products, tools and technology to add value to the business; ensuring that applications are on the right platform.
- Work with Product Owners, other developers and business users through the project life cycle to gather and understand requirements, determine best solutions, test solutions and demonstrate functionality to end users.
- Ensure all application changes are developed, tested, and implemented in a well-controlled environment.
- Follow modern application architecture guidelines and design principles such as separation of concerns, single responsibility, and least knowledge.
- Design, develop and maintain technical architecture framework via SOA and Microservices.
- Deploy code through an established automated deployment framework.
- Create user-centric applications by considering customer feedback, technical constraints, opportunities and usability findings.
- Enforce test-driven development (TDD) and continuous integration.
Preferred Qualifications
- Gosu Programming Language
- You know Node.js, AngularJS, and ReactJS
- You’re a pro at developing data-backed applications using a combination of REST, SSIS, RDBMS technologies
- Azure and/or AWS experience with App Services, SQL Server, Function and Logic Apps